Explore Safety Topics: Bicycle Safety.According to National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) data, Texas fell below the national average for seat belt use in 2021. This is particularly noteworthy because, in the two decades before 2021, Texas had consistently ranked higher than the national average. Failure to buckle up was just one of several risky driving behaviors ... In 2022, 11,302 people killed in car crashes were not wearing seat belts. The national estimate of seat belt use during the day by adult front-seat passengers in 2023 was 91.9%. In 2022, more unrestrained passenger vehicle occupants died in traffic crashes at night (6,252) than during the day (4,949). In 2022, 57% of passenger vehicle occupants ...

Seat belts reduce serious crash-related injuries and deaths by about half. 12. Seat belts saved almost 15,000 lives in 2017. 5. Air bags provide added protection but are not a substitute for seat belts. Air bags plus seat belts provide the greatest protection for adults. 13.44% of motor vehicle crash deaths among teens ages 13–19 occurred between 9 pm and 6 am, and 50% occurred on Friday, Saturday, or Sunday in 2020. 2. All states have seat belt laws, except New Hampshire. Laws requiring seat belt use are either “primary” or “secondary” enforcement laws. ... two recent studies on the effects of seat belt law types on traffic death rates during 2000–2014 13 and 2000–2016 14 found no impact 13 or a small impact 14 on crash fatality rates.Since 2018, the Ohio State Highway Patrol has issued over 475,000 safety belt and child safety seat citations. Safety Belt Violations In 2022, Ohio’s observed safety belt usage rate was 80.8%, down from the 2021 rate of 84.1% and the lowest compliance rate since 20052. Women (89.5%) were more likely to wear safety belts than men (82.0%).However, in 2022, the number of people who died while not wearing a seat belt increased by 2.5% over 2021, with 1,258 unbuckled drivers and passengers killed on Texas roadways. ... Safety belts are the most important safety system in motor vehicles and when worn intend to prevent serious injuries. [ 1, 2, 3] Seat belts reduce the severity of injury caused by restraining vehicle occupants and thus preventing them from hitting objects or being ejected through windows.
